Which cities can I fly to direct from Port Moresby?

There are loads of places you can fly direct to from Port Moresby. The most popular destinations for direct flights among KAYAK users are Lae, Mount Hagen and Goroka. On average, the cheapest of these destinations on KAYAK over the last 2 weeks for a return flight was Lae at $146, while the most expensive was Mount Hagen, at $244.

Which international cities can I fly to direct from Port Moresby?

There are many international destinations you can fly to non-stop from Port Moresby. The most popular international destinations from KAYAK users are Brisbane and Manila. On average, the cheapest of these destinations on KAYAK over the last 2 weeks for a return flight was Manila at $309, while the most expensive was Brisbane, at $344.

What is the longest direct flight from Port Moresby?

The longest direct flight you can take from Port Moresby is to Guangzhou, with a duration of 7h 00m. The next longest is Hong Kong at 6h 40m, followed by a flight to Singapore at 6h 40m.

  • What is Port Moresby also known as?

    Port Moresby Jackson Fld Airport’s airport code is POM. It can also be referred to as Jackson Field, Jackson Fld, Jacksons Intl, Port Moresby.
